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

Emulsifier particles and methods for making and using same. The emulsifier particles can include an alkali metal salt or an alkaline earth metal salt of a carboxylic acid terminated fatty amine condensate, an alkali metal salt or an alkaline earth metal salt of a modified tall oil, or a blend of an alkali metal salt or an alkaline earth metal salt of a carboxylic acid terminated fatty amine condensate and an alkali metal salt or an alkaline earth metal salt of a modified tall oil. The emulsifier particles can have a BET specific surface area of about 0.3 m2/g to about 1 m2/g. The method for making the emulsifier particles can include reducing a size of an emulsifier solid via a mechanical attrition process to produce the emulsifier particles.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

What is claimed is: 1 . A method for making emulsifier particles, the method comprising reducing a size of an emulsifier solid via a mechanical attrition process to produce emulsifier particles having a BET specific surface area of about 0.3 m 2 /g to about 1 m 2 /g, wherein: the emulsifier solid comprises: (1) an alkali metal salt or an alkaline earth metal salt of a carboxylic acid terminated fatty amine condensate, (2) an alkali metal salt or an alkaline earth metal salt of a modified tall oil, or (3) a blend of an alkali metal salt or an alkaline earth metal salt of a carboxylic acid terminated fatty amine condensate and an alkali metal salt or an alkaline earth metal salt of a modified tall oil. 2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the mechanical attrition process includes at least one of: grinding, milling, or a combination of grinding and milling. 3 . The method of claim 1 , further comprising removing a liquid from a liquid composition to produce the emulsifier solid, wherein the liquid composition comprises (1) the alkali metal salt or an alkaline earth metal salt of a carboxylic acid terminated fatty amine condensate, (2) the alkali metal salt or an alkaline earth metal salt of a modified tall oil, or (3) the blend of an alkali metal salt or an alkaline earth metal salt of a carboxylic acid terminated fatty amine condensate and an alkali metal salt or an alkaline earth metal salt of a modified tall oil. 4 . The method of claim 3 , wherein the liquid includes water. 5 . The method of claim 3 , wherein removing the liquid from the liquid composition to produce the emulsifier solid comprises distilling the liquid composition to produce a molten emulsifier. 6 . The method of claim 5 , wherein removing the liquid from the liquid composition to produce the emulsifier solid further comprises cooling the molten emulsifier to produce the emulsifier solid. 7 . The method of claim 6 , wherein cooling the molten emulsifier to produce the emulsifier solid comprises contacting the molten emulsifier with a substrate having a temperature less than the melting point of the molten emulsifier. 8 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the emulsifier particles comprise the alkali metal salt or the alkaline earth metal salt of the modified tall oil and the method further comprises at least one of: adding an alkali metal hydroxide, an alkaline earth metal hydroxide, an alkali metal oxide, an alkaline earth metal oxide, or any mixture thereof to a modified tall oil, to produce the alkali metal salt or the alkaline earth metal salt of the modified tall oil; reacting a tall oil distillate component and an unsaturated polycarboxylic acid, a carboxylic anhydride, or a mixture of an unsaturated polycarboxylic acid and a carboxylic anhydride, to produce the modified tall oil; or a combination thereof. 9 . The method of claim 8 , wherein at least one of: the tall oil distillate component comprises tall oil fatty acids, tall oil rosin acids, or a mixture thereof; the unsaturated polycarboxylic acid comprises maleic acid, fumaric acid, phthalic acid, trans-2-hexenedioic acid, trans-3-hexenedioic acid, cis-3-octenedioic acid, cis-4-octenedioic acid, trans-3-octenedioic acid, succinic acid, or any mixture thereof; the carboxylic anhydride comprises maleic anhydride, succinic anhydride, or a mixture thereof; or a combination thereof. 10 . The method of claim 1 , further comprising reacting a tall oil distillate component with maleic anhydride to produce the modified tall oil, wherein the tall oil distillate component comprises tall oil fatty acids, tall oil rosin acids, or a mixture thereof. 11 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the emulsifier particles comprise the alkali metal salt or the alkaline earth metal salt of the carboxylic acid terminated fatty amine condensate, and wherein the method further comprises at least one of: adding an alkali metal hydroxide, an alkaline earth metal hydroxide, an alkali metal oxide, an alkaline earth metal oxide, or any mixture thereof to a carboxylic acid terminated fatty amine condensate, to produce the alkali metal salt or the alkaline earth metal salt of the carboxylic acid terminated fatty amine condensate by; reacting a fatty acid amine condensate and a polycarboxylic acid, a carboxylic anhydride, or a mixture of a polycarboxylic acid and a carboxylic anhydride, to produce the carboxylic acid terminated fatty amine condensate; or a combination thereof. 12 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the emulsifier particles have at least one of: a BET specific surface area of about 0.3 m 2 /g to about 1 m 2 /g; a BET pore volume of at least 0.001 cm 3 /g to about 0.005 cm 3 /g; a BET average pore width of about 50 angstroms to about 200 angstroms; a bulk density of about 0.3 g/cm 3 to about 0.6 g/cm 3; a weight average particle size of about 5 μm to less than 80 μm; or a combination thereof. 13 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the emulsifier particles have a BET specific surface area of about 0.5 m 2 /g to about 1 m 2 /g. 14 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the emulsifier particles have at least one of: a bulk density of about 0.4 g/cm 3 to about 0.6 g/cm 3 ; a BET average pore width of about 50 angstroms to about 150 angstroms; or a combination thereof. 15 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the emulsifier particles have: a Krumbein roundness of 0.1 to less than 0.8, and a Krumbein sphericity of 0.1 to less than 0.8. 16 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the emulsifier particles have a BET pore volume of at least 0.0012 cm 3 /g to about 0.002 cm 3 /g. 17 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the emulsifier particles have an average particle size of less than 54 μm. 18 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the emulsifier particles have at least one of: a BET specific surface area of about 0.5 m 2 /g to about 1 m 2 /g; a BET pore volume of at least 0.0012 cm 3 /g to about 0.003 cm 3 /g; a BET average pore width of about 50 angstroms to about 150 angstroms; or a combination thereof. 19 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the emulsifier particles have at least one of: a bulk density of about 0.3 g/cm 3 to about 0.6 g/cm 3 ; a BET pore volume of at least 0.0012 cm 3 /g to about 0.002 cm 3 /g; a BET average pore width of about 50 angstroms to less than 100 angstroms; or a combination thereof. 20 . The emulsifier particles of claim 1 , wherein the emulsifier particles have at least one of: a BET specific surface area of at least 0.5 m 2 /g to about 1 m 2 /g; a BET pore volume of at least 0.0012 cm 3 /g to about 0.002 cm 3 /g; a BET average pore width of about 50 angstroms to less than 100 angstroms; a weight average particle size of about 5 μm to less than 27 μm; an average Krumbein roundness of 0.1 to 0.7; a bulk density of about 0.3 g/cm 3 to about 0.6 g/cm 3 ; or a combination thereof.
